Skip to main content
Search

CODESYS LD FBD

When the CODESYS LD FBD add-on is installed in your development environment, you can graphically create programming objects for controller applications in the LD or FBD languages according to IEC 61131-3.

LD stands for Ladder Diagram. The programming language graphically represents the classic wiring of relays.

FBD stands for Function Block Diagram. A programming block in FBD is also called a function block language (FBD). The graphical programming language allows for programming with boxes whose function is provided by the system, by own programming, or by libraries.

Programming objects implemented in LD or FBD can be switched to the other programming language. Moreover, it is possible to switch to the now deprecated IL programming language.

IL stands for Instruction List and is used for the logical linking of controller inputs and outputs.

You can use the CODESYS Installer to update the CODESYS LD FBD add-on.

Tip

IL can be enabled in the CODESYS options if required: In the FBD, LD and IL dialog, on the IL tab, select the Enable IL option.